JAKARTA - Actor Johnny Depp is reportedly trying to get Amber Heard out of production for the Aquaman sequel after losing a trial to British media calling her a wife beater.

Launching The Hollywood Reporter today, Thursday, December 10, Depp asked for help from his older brother, Christi Dembrowski who is a producer and has a big influence at the Warner Bros. production house.

"I want him (Amber Heard) to be replaced in the WB film," said Depp.

According to THR, the word WB film hints at the Aquaman film in which Amber Heard plays Mera.

Previously, Amber Heard raised her voice regarding the petition asking her to quit Aquaman production because of a domestic case with Depp. This 34-year-old actress is not afraid of the petition that has already been signed by more than 1.5 million people.

"The rumors and paid campaigns have no effect because they have no basis in the real world. Only fans can make Aquaman and Aquaman 2 happen. I'm excited to start (production) next year."

Johnny Depp lost his lawsuit against The Sun media and editor Dan Wootton after calling Depp a wife beater (wife beater).

Then, Depp was asked by Warner Bros. to leave the production of the third film Fantastic Beasts which is in the process of filming. Even though he had only recorded one scene, Johnny Depp received all the fees written in the contract.

On the other hand, actor Mads Mikkelsen will play Gellert Grindelwald replacing Depp.
